What's Happening?
Virginia Fonseca, a well-known influencer, announced that she will be taking a break from social media to focus on the recovery of her daughters, Maria Alice and Maria Flor, who recently underwent surgery. The procedure was performed to address enlarged
tonsils and adenoids, which had been causing sleep disturbances. Fonseca shared the news on Instagram, expressing relief that the surgeries were successful and emphasizing her desire to dedicate her time to her daughters' recovery. She mentioned that she will remain offline until her daughters receive medical clearance. Fonseca also highlighted the importance of being present for her children during this time, indicating that she has no immediate plans to return to her regular posting schedule.
